Just one correction: Sun didn't create MySQL, it bought it. And then Oracle
bought Sun. Monty lasted about a month in the Oracle business
sphere/ecology before quitting to start MariaDB. Although the Oracle/MySQL
team does put out enhancements, the MariaDB team is way ahead in terms of
new features, and the MySQL team is basically playing catch-up. Since
MariaDB is a drop-in replacement for MySQL, a significant number of MySQL
users have moved on to MariaDB.

Finally, a note of trivia. Monty names his databases after his daughters.
